Sep 30, 2021 8:25 AM in response to B2Bene

An Apple ID is just user identification. It does not have to be an active email account to just to log in to your Apple ID or iCloud (although you should change the Apple ID to a different email address for future convenience). If you deleted your Apple ID account (as opposed to your email account) that was a mistake, nothing purchased or downloaded with it can ever be used again. If you still have the Apple ID account you can just change the email address associated with it→Change your Apple ID - Apple Support

Sep 30, 2021 9:28 AM in response to B2Bene

See→How to delete your Apple ID account - Apple Support


Specifically:

When your Apple ID account is deleted, your account details and the data associated with your Apple ID are permanently deleted from Apple’s servers. You can't sign in to your account, and you won’t be able to access any data, content, or services that were associated with your Apple ID.


Photos, videos, documents, and other content that you stored in iCloud are permanently deleted; you can't receive any messages or calls sent to your account via iMessage, FaceTime, or iCloud Mail; and you can't sign in to or use services such as iCloud, the App Store, iTunes Store, Apple Books, Apple Pay, iMessage, FaceTime, and Find My iPhone. In addition, any Apple Store appointments and AppleCare support cases are canceled.


Deleting your Apple ID is permanent. After your account is deleted, Apple can't reopen or reactivate your account or restore your data. If you aren’t planning to use your account for now but may consider returning to it in the future, we recommend temporarily deactivating your account (where available) instead of deleting it.
